Determine the size of door you need

If you are looking for an interior door that will last, the best way to know what entry size to get is by measuring your doorway. This will ensure that it fits well and looks great in your home. If you don't have a huge opening, this could be something as simple as buying an off-the-shelf door or having someone custom build one for you. You can get a professional to help you measure your entryway as well.

The cost will vary depending on the type of material being used and the level of customization desired. On average, people can expect to pay anywhere from $300-$1,000 for a custom-made interior door with standard features. However, suppose there are any special requirements, such as fire-rated doors or other safety specifications. In that case, prices may go up significantly higher than this due to the extra work.

Choose the type of interior door

Experts such as HyBar Windows and Doors will help you understand the different types of doors available. Choosing the correct type of door is not just about aesthetics. It's also about functionality and safety. For example, barn doors suit high ceilings and large spaces because they span an extensive area.

Sliding doors open inwards to save space when closed. And pocket doors slide into walls on both sides, so they take up no floor space at all — perfect for small apartments or homes with traditional layouts that preserve formal living rooms or dining rooms.
